Judge says has no jurisdiction to order ExxonMobil to provide proof of US$2b guarantee

Justice of Appeal Rishi Persaud has said that he does not have jurisdiction to order ExxonMobil to provide proof that it has indeed lodged a US$2 billion guarantee which is intended to indemnify Guyana against an oil spill and associated perils.

Stabroek News understands that in a brief ruling handed down yesterday morning, Justice Persaud dismissed the summons which sought proof that ExxonMobil had lodged the money as it claimed. Justice Persaud ruled that he has no jurisdiction to make the order sought.

According to a source, the Judge expressed concern that the Applicants had to move to the court to request proof that the sum has indeed been lodged, while adding that in the interest of transparency, it is hoped that the specific issue can be resolved.
